Kentaroh Watanabe is a scholar working on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ics and Biomedical Engineering. According to data from OpenAlex, Kentaroh Watanabe has authored 106 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 101 papers in Electrical and Electronic Engineering, 75 papers in Atomic and Molecular Physics, and Optics and 36 papers in Biomedical Engineering. Recurrent topics in Kentaroh Watanabe’s work include solar cell performance optimization (76 papers), Semiconductor Quantum Structures and Devices (65 papers) and Chalcogenide Semiconductor Thin Films (45 papers). Kentaroh Watanabe is often cited by papers focused on solar cell performance optimization (76 papers), Semiconductor Quantum Structures and Devices (65 papers) and Chalcogenide Semiconductor Thin Films (45 papers). Kentaroh Watanabe collaborates with scholars based in Japan, France and China. Kentaroh Watanabe's co-authors include Masakazu Sugiyama, Yoshiaki Nakano, Hiromasa Fujii, Hassanet Sodabanlu and Kasidit Toprasertpong and has published in prestigious journals such as Applied Physics Letters, Journal of Applied Physics and International Journal of Hydrogen Energy.
